Tho enclosed petition numcrougly
l(;noilwnB prcsouted to tho city
coifndl on Monday nlRht nnd ovi
denco Is bchiB Hccurod for prosecu presecu prosecu
teon: To the honorable members of tho
city council of Butte Fall, Jackson
county, Orcson.
VI10roan It Is commonly reported
that Intoxicating llijuorfl nro being
nold In Unite Falls In violation of
law with tho tiflual concomltuuts of
vlco nnd hnnio, wo your petitioners
respectively request Hint you take
such stops as nro necessary to sccuro
evidence, In ordor to convict nnd pun
ish tho guilty parties nnd rcmovn this
inonnco to tho Reed naino nnd moral
welfnro of our fair city.
INVENTOR OF VOLAPUK
UNIVERSAL LANGUAGE, DEAD
CON8TANCB, Radon, Aug. 21.
Jolinnn Schloycr, who Invented Vola
puk, tho artificial Inngungo for In
tornntUniaUnsot Is dead today at tils
homo bore.
